#6550f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6550f5 is composed of 39.6% red, 31.4%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.8%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 247.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 63.7%. #6550f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#caa0ff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#6550f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6550f5 has RGB values of R:101, G:80,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6639861.

Shades and Tints of #6550f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010b is the darkest color, while #f8f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6550f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9ea7 is the less saturated color, while #6049fc is the most saturated one.
